Somalia's average electricity rates around $0. 535 per kWh rank among the highest in the region, driven by heavy reliance on diesel, limited grid coverage, and expensive fuel transport.

This makes Eswatini an electricity deficient country, with demand outstripping supply by a wide margin. Eswatini currently imports 70-80% of its electricity from South Africa and Mozambique, primarily through a bilateral agreement with South Africa, which is set to expire around 2025.
